Widener Overview
Widener University (Widener) is a four-year, private (not-for-profit) school located in Chester, PA. It is classified as Doctoral / Research University by Carnegie Classification, also known as D/PU (Doctoral/Professional University). You can compare their tuition and admission statistics at D/PU (Doctoral/Professional University) comparison page.
The Widener's tuition & fees is $55,730 for the academic year 2024-2025. 93% of the enrolled undergraduates have received grants or scholarships, with an average aid amount of $40,208.
The school has a total enrollment of 5,713 and the students to faculty ratio is 11 to 1 (9.09%).
Widener's acceptance rate is 70.93% and the yield (enrollment rate) is 13.81%. The median SAT score is 1180.
Widener ranked 246th in National Universities and 64th in Pennsylvania Colleges rankings. Widener University is accredited by Middle States Commission on Higher Education.

Learning Opportunities and Campus Services
Widener University offers online classes (distance learning opportunities) for both undergraduate and graduate programs. It has ROTC programs and offers teacher certification programs designed to prepare students to meet the requirements for certification as teachers.
